King Solomon & the Queen of Sheba 所羅門的智慧


範圍:
1 King 3:4-15
列王記上第三章第四節~十五節
1 King 3:16-28
列王記上第三章第十六節~廿八節
1 King 10:1-10
列王記上第十章第一節~十節
1 King 11:1-6
列王記上第十一章第一節~六節

名句節選:
So give your servant a discerning heart to govern your people and to distinguish between right and wrong. For who is able to govern this great people of yours? (1Ka. 3:9)
所以求你賜我智慧,可以判斷你的民,能辨別是非。不然,誰能判斷這眾多的民呢。 (列上 第三章第九節)

Q1: What did Solomon ask from God?

Answer: "So give your servant a discerning heart to govern your people and to distinguish between right and wrong." 1 King 3:9



Q2: What else did God give Solomon because He was pleased with what Soloman asked for?

Answer: "Moreover, I will give you what you have not asked for—both wealth and honor—so that in your lifetime you will have no equal among kings." 1 King 3:13



Q3: What was queen of Sheba's conclusion about the relationship between God and Solomon?

Answer: "Praise be to the LORD your God, who has delighted in you and placed you on the throne of Israel. Because of the LORD's eternal love for Israel, he has made you king to maintain justice and righteousness." 1 King 10:9
